Solution for 56x2=120 equation:



56x^2=120
We move all terms to the left:
56x^2-(120)=0
a = 56; b = 0; c = -120;
Δ = b2-4ac
Δ = 02-4·56·(-120)
Δ = 26880
The delta value is higher than zero, so the equation has two solutions
We use following formulas to calculate our solutions:
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$

The end solution:
$\sqrt{\Delta}=\sqrt{26880}=\sqrt{256*105}=\sqrt{256}*\sqrt{105}=16\sqrt{105}$
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(0)-16\sqrt{105}}{2*56}=\frac{0-16\sqrt{105}}{112} =-\frac{16\sqrt{105}}{112} =-\frac{\sqrt{105}}{7} $
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(0)+16\sqrt{105}}{2*56}=\frac{0+16\sqrt{105}}{112} =\frac{16\sqrt{105}}{112} =\frac{\sqrt{105}}{7} $
